Kent Knowles is an American figurative painter and sculptor. The characters that populate his work are often women in perilous situations, occupying lush terrain.
His most recent interests explore self-preservation and isolation.
Kent lives on the outskirts of Atlanta with his wife and two children and is the Associate Dean of Fine Arts and Foundation Studies at Savannah College of Art and Design. In addition.
Kent is the author and illustrator of the children’s book Lucius and the Storm (Red Cygnet Press, 2007).to

Oil on canvas painting by the contemporary American artist, Michael Patterson. Signed lower left. Framed in a contemporary dark wood frame 46 by 35.5 inches.
Michael Patterson was born in Hudson, NY in 1953 into a family of painters. Howard Ashman Patterson, his grandfather, was an established American painter. Michael graduated from Suny Purchase with honors in painting, printmaking, and sculpture. He has been painting for thirty-five years or so, doing extensive traveling for inspiration.
Michael focuses on light, reflected light and its color effects, as well as the positive and negative shapes of equal importance, create the graphic energy of my compositions. This sets the rhythm for a piece and influences where the viewer’s eye travels and at what pace.
He includes curved lines with straight, organic shapes juxtaposed geometric shapes woven together, always conscious of the line created by any color masses converging. This line flows throughout, interrupted, yet continuous. The subject of his work most always includes the human figure wherever they may be- city streets, markets, the beach, alone or in groups. People are the most interesting part of creation.
His travels include Vermont, Maine, California, New Mexico, Hawaii, Costa Rica, Ecuador, and Europe. He lived in France for several years. Michael has shown his work in Europe and the U.S., primarily in the Northeast.
